看板 [ MATLAB ]
討論串[問題] 產生所有[1~H 1~H 1~H .. 1~H]這些vector
共 4 篇文章
首頁
上一頁
1
下一頁
尾頁

推噓2(2推 0噓 3→)留言5則,0人參與, 最新作者DigiPrince (幻無影)時間15年前 (2010/05/31 13:18), 編輯資訊
0
0
0
內容預覽:
本來想轉當個潛水員了,不過這是之前回過的問題就回完整些囉~. 就如先前所提到的,上一篇的方法是先產生出所有可能的 h,. 將這堆 h 放在 X 矩陣中以供取用。. 這樣的優點是產生速度快、程式碼簡短。. 缺點則是因為 X 矩陣大小會是 (H^n)*n,隨著 n 的成長非常快,. 所以如果你的 n 稍
(還有413個字)

推噓0(0推 0噓 7→)留言7則,0人參與, 最新作者GSXSP (Gloria)時間15年前 (2010/05/31 01:57), 編輯資訊
0
0
0
內容預覽:
這個方法好像沒辦法處理太大的耶. 例如說. H = 1:8; % index range. n = 10; % number of digits. 這樣好像就matrix過大了. 不曉得有沒有辦法改善呢?. --. 發信站: 批踢踢實業坊(ptt.cc). ◆ From: 140.113.211

推噓1(1推 0噓 0→)留言1則,0人參與, 最新作者DigiPrince (幻無影)時間15年前 (2010/05/25 01:11), 編輯資訊
0
0
0
內容預覽:
假設你的各個 h 為一長度 5 的向量且每一個元素的範圍為 1~7,. 則生出那堆 h 向量的程式碼可寫成如下:. H = 1:7; % index range. n = 5; % number of digits. [X{n:-1:1}] = ndgrid(H);. X = reshape(cat
(還有32個字)

推噓0(0推 0噓 3→)留言3則,0人參與, 最新作者GSXSP (Gloria)時間15年前 (2010/05/24 22:40), 編輯資訊
0
0
0
內容預覽:
我想要做summation. [h_1 h_2 ... h_n]. h_i = 1,2,...,H. 所以我要產生. h = [h_1 h_2 ... h_n] 總共 2^H 個vector. 不知道有沒有什麼建議的做法呢?. 我目前能想到的兩個做法. (1). for h(1) = 1:H. fo
(還有39個字)
首頁
上一頁
1
下一頁
尾頁